Core Insights - The article highlights the successful launch and popularity of the mascots "Xiyangyang" and "Lerongrong" during the 15th National Games held in Guangzhou, which has led to a surge in sales of related merchandise [1][8][11]. Group 1: Event and Mascot Popularity - The 15th National Games is the first to be jointly hosted by Guangdong, Hong Kong, and Macau, featuring mascots inspired by the Chinese white dolphin, symbolizing joy and unity [1][2]. - The event has created a vibrant atmosphere in Guangzhou, with large mascots displayed throughout the city, attracting significant public attention [2][4]. Group 2: Merchandise Sales and Consumer Behavior - The company Yuanzhong Yatu has developed over 2,800 licensed products for the event, with more than 700 physical retail stores and over 70 online stores [6][8]. - Sales have seen explosive growth, with offline sales exceeding 300,000 yuan in October, further increasing to 100,000 yuan daily after the opening ceremony [8][11]. - The interactive nature of products, such as the rotating figurines of the mascots, has contributed to their popularity among consumers [11]. Group 3: Market Trends and Future Prospects - The article notes the increasing importance of event IP (intellectual property) in driving consumer spending, with a focus on integrating cultural elements into everyday life [11][12]. - The Chinese retail market is projected to grow significantly, with total retail sales expected to exceed 50 trillion yuan this year [11]. - The company is expanding its IP collaborations, having signed agreements with major brands like Universal Pictures and the NBA, indicating a strategic move towards enhancing its market presence [12][13].

Core Viewpoint - Lisheng Sports has demonstrated strong financial performance in the first half of 2025, driven by increased revenue from overseas events and venue operations, indicating effective execution of its internationalization strategy [1][2].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Lisheng Sports achieved operating revenue of 272 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 21.94%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 15.32 million yuan, up 11.97% [1]. - The second quarter saw a remarkable net profit surge of 319% compared to the same period last year [1]. Business Segments - The core business of sports event management generated 192 million yuan in revenue, reflecting a 30.2% year-on-year increase, accounting for 70.62% of total revenue [1]. - Venue operations contributed 67.17 million yuan, with a 22.74% increase, raising its revenue share to 24.72% [1]. International Expansion - Lisheng Sports has successfully expanded its international presence, with overseas revenue reaching 141 million yuan, a 16.41% increase, making up 52.05% of total revenue [2]. - The company has hosted various racing events across multiple regions in China, enhancing its domestic market presence [2]. New Opportunities in Sports - The company is exploring new opportunities in the sports sector by expanding its IP operations into golf, having become the exclusive official operator for the China Men's Professional Golf Tour [3]. - Lisheng Sports has successfully organized seven golf events by mid-2025, attracting over 200 top domestic and international players [3]. Strategic Projects - The company is advancing the construction of the Hainan International Circuit, with an investment of 184 million yuan, positioning it as a key project for the development of the automotive and tourism sectors in Hainan [4]. - The circuit aims to enhance Lisheng Sports' visibility and influence in the new energy vehicle and motorsport sectors [4]. Policy Alignment - Lisheng Sports is aligning its strategies with national policies aimed at boosting sports consumption and industry development, particularly through the Hainan International Circuit project [5][6]. - The company is focused on creating a comprehensive service platform for sports consumption, leveraging policy support for sustainable growth [6].
